Normal state electronic structure in the heavily overdoped regime of Bi1.74Pb0.38Sr1.88CuO6+delta single-layer cuprate superconductors
arXiv:cond-mat/0602418 · doi:10.1103/PhysRevB.73.144507
Abstract
We explore the electronic structure in the heavily overdoped regime of the single layer cuprate superconductor Bi1.74Pb0.38Sr1.88CuO6+delta. We found that the nodal quasiparticle behavior is dominated mostly by phonons, while the antinodal quasiparticle lineshape is dominated by spin fluctuations. Moreover, while long range spin fluctuations diminish at very high doping, the local magnetic fluctuations still dominate the quasiparticle dispersion, and the system exhibits a strange metal behavior in the entire overdoped regime.
